| Stage | Period | Key Nutrition |
|---|---|---|
| Pre-conception | Before conception | Folic acid, iron, balanced diet |
| Pregnancy | Conception to birth (270 days) | Macronutrients + micronutrients |
| Exclusive breastfeeding | 0-6 months | Breast milk only |
| Complementary feeding | 6-24 months | Breast milk + appropriate complementary foods |
| Nutrient | Daily Dose | Purpose |
|---|---|---|
| Folic acid | 400 mcg pre-conception; 5 mg in cases of NTD risk | Neural tube defect prevention |
| Iron | 60 mg elemental iron (IFA tablets) | Prevents maternal anaemia, reduces LBW |
| Calcium | 1200 mg/day | Fetal bone development, prevents pre-eclampsia |
| Iodine | 220 mcg/day | Thyroid, brain development |
| Vitamin D | 400 IU/day | Calcium absorption |
| Zinc | 11-12 mg/day | Cell growth, immunity |
| Day Count | Period | Key Action |
|---|---|---|
| Day 1-270 | Pregnancy | Adequate diet, IFA, folic acid, ANC visits |
| Day 271-450 | 0-6 months | Exclusive breastfeeding |
| Day 451-1000 | 6-24 months | Breastfeeding + complementary feeding |
| Beyond day 1000 | 2-3 years | Sustain gains; Anganwadi support |
